通过合理配置Apache2服务器,可以提升网站性能和安全性,从而在一定程度上提升网站的排名。以下是一些关键的配置建议和步骤:
基本配置
- 安装Apache2:在大多数Linux发行版中,可以使用包管理器安装Apache2,例如在Debian/Ubuntu系统中使用
sudo apt-get install apache2
。
- 配置虚拟主机:通过配置虚拟主机,可以为不同的域名或端口提供不同的网站内容。这不仅可以提高资源利用率,还能为不同的用户群体提供更好的体验。
- 修改默认端口:为了避免与其他服务(如Nginx)冲突,可以修改Apache的默认端口。例如,将默认端口80修改为81。
安全性配置
- 关闭不必要的模块:通过禁用不需要的模块,可以减少攻击面并提高服务器的安全性。
- 配置防火墙:确保只允许必要的端口和服务通过防火墙,例如允许HTTP(端口80)和HTTPS(端口443)通过,并关闭其他端口。
性能优化
- 启用缓存:通过配置缓存机制,可以减少服务器的负载并加快页面加载速度。
- 启用Gzip压缩:启用Gzip压缩可以减少网络传输的数据量,从而提高页面加载速度。
监控和维护
- 定期更新:保持Apache及其模块的最新状态,以修复已知的安全漏洞和提升性能。
- 监控服务器状态:使用工具如
netstat
来监控服务器的运行状态,确保所有服务正常运行。
需要注意的是,提升网站排名不仅仅依赖于服务器的配置,还包括网站内容的质量、用户体验、SEO优化等多个方面。同时,在配置服务器时,应确保遵循最佳实践和安全指南,以避免潜在的安全风险。